AECOM is a leading global infrastructure consulting firm dedicated to delivering a better world through innovative solutions in planning, design, engineering, and construction management. With a workforce of over 50,000 professionals, AECOM partners with clients to tackle complex challenges across various sectors, including transportation, buildings, water, and new energy. The company emphasizes a culture of equity, diversity, and inclusion, and is committed to environmental, social, and governance priorities. As a Fortune 500 firm, AECOM generated $14.4 billion in revenue in fiscal year 2023, showcasing its role as a trusted advisor in the infrastructure space.
